The Yamaha XJ6 Diversion motorcycle was released in 2013 with a four-stroke, transverse four-cylinder engine that has a capacity of 600 cc. It uses a liquid cooling system and has a compression ratio of 12.2:1. The motorcycle has a group injection type fuel injection and TCI ignition, and uses an electric starting system. It provides a max power output of 78 hp and max torque of 59.7 Nm. The XJ6 Diversion also features a wet multi-plate clutch and a six-speed transmission with a chain final drive.
The frame of the motorcycle is an aluminum die-cast, diamond-shaped frame. The front suspension uses a 43mm telescopic fork that allows for a wheel travel of up to 130mm, while the rear suspension is a swingarm linkless type monocross that also has a wheel travel of up to 130mm. The motorcycle has a front brake system with two 298mm discs and a rear brake system with a single 245mm disc. The front and rear tires are 120/70 ZR17 and 160/60 ZR17 respectively, and the motorcycle has a wheelbase of 1440mm with a seat height of 785mm. It weighs in at 211kg and has a fuel capacity of 17.3 Litres.
